Results, order, filter

Exelon Careers 2 Jobs in Delaware

  • General Engineer

    Exelon - Newark, Delaware
    ... Engineer (2) (3) Ability to analyze and interpret complex electrical and mechanical systems ... department) OR Engineer in Training OR 50% complete (by hours) with advanced technical degree, M.B ...
  • Sr Project Const Manager

    Exelon - Newark, Delaware
    ... Who We Are We're powering a cleaner, brighter future. Exelon is leading the energy ...